Output ec823baffb740262334fe4c577bb9a2bfff660f0dc5fc457b36c11a8d128554d:0

value
3759
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f4f524f7be73d03013b39d820b01f54cae2c0620d5645337ed077c339e164765
address
bc1p7n6jfaa7w0grqyannkpqkq04fjhzcp3q64j9xdldqa7r88skgajslchm7d
transaction
ec823baffb740262334fe4c577bb9a2bfff660f0dc5fc457b36c11a8d128554d
confirmations
46923
spent
true